State Police are asking for the public’s help in locating a pickup truck that was reported stolen on Monday morning in Schuylkill County.
According to information from the PSP-Schuylkill Haven barracks, the reported theft happened sometime between 11:30 p.m. Sunday (April 3) and 6:30 a.m. Monday (April 4). The owner of the truck on Rock Rd., Washington Twp., says someone got away with his 1999 Ford F-350.
The truck has some very identifiable characteristics:
- A 50-gallong fuel tank attached to the truck bed, behind the cab;
- Duallys on the rear axle;
- Silver, diamond-plated running boards.
